Are you a seasoned engineering professional with a passion for operational excellence in meat processing? Kepak Merthyr Tydfil is seeking a Principal Engineer to lead and innovate across our abattoir, boning, and slaughter operations, driving performance, safety, and sustainability in a fast-paced, high-volume environment.

About the Role:

As Principal Engineer, you will be the technical authority across our site’s processing operations, responsible for:

- Leading engineering strategy and continuous improvement initiatives in slaughter and boning areas.

- Overseeing equipment reliability, maintenance planning, and OPEX projects.

- Collaborating with production, quality assurance, and animal welfare teams to ensure compliance and efficiency.

- Driving automation, energy efficiency, and waste reduction across the site.

- Mentoring site engineers and maintenance teams, fostering a culture of safety and innovation.

What We’re Looking For:

- Degree-qualified in Mechanical, Electrical, or Process Engineering (or equivalent).

- Proven experience in abattoir or meat processing environments, ideally in boning and slaughter operations.

- Strong leadership and project management skills.

- Knowledge of regulatory standards (e.g., food safety, animal welfare, environmental compliance).

- Excellent problem-solving and stakeholder engagement abilities.

Health & Safety Focus:

- Demonstrated commitment to workplace safety and compliance with H&S regulations.

- Experience implementing risk assessments and safe systems of work in high-risk environments.

- Ability to lead incident investigations and drive corrective actions.

- Familiarity with HACCP, COSHH, and other relevant safety protocols in meat processing.
